Position Summary

A Standardized Patient (SP) is an individual from the communitywho is trained to portray a simulated patient case in a standardized manner.Requirements for this on-call position include the capacity for standardizingwith other SPs who are cast in the same simulated patient case. These cases areused to teach and test clinical students' patient care and communicationskills. Therefore, to be standardized, SPs must have matching physicalattributes for the available roles.

The capacity for standardization may be limited by certain physicalcharacteristics or medical conditions such as surgical scars, tattoos,prosthetic limbs, muscle weakness, hearing loss, etc. SPs must be able to stepup and down from an examination table, quickly change clothes, in and out of agown, and perform physical tasks, which require full range of motion of limbs,such as raising arms overhead. SPs are required to provide ethnicity, age,gender and medical history in order to be cast in cases in a standardizedmanner.

Under training and close supervision in a clinicaleducational setting, consistently and accurately portrays specific emotions,behaviors, and physical disease symptoms while interacting with students in thehealth care field during simulated patient encounters designed to enablestudent experiential learning and/or assessment of student skills. Works variedhours on an on-call in-person basis.

Other skills required to perform successfully as SP include beingdetail-oriented, and having an excellent memory and communication skills. SPsmust consent to being filmed for educational purposes. After hire, photographswill be taken and confidential information will be collected and maintained for casting purposes.
